Preview: Paris Saint-Germain vs. Toulouse

Sports Mole previews the Ligue 1 clash between Paris Saint-Germain and Toulouse.

Paris Saint-Germain must turn their attention to a gripping Ligue 1 title race this weekend when they host Toulouse in the French capital.

A three-horse race between PSG, Marseille and leaders Lyon was put to one side in midweek as Laurent Blanc's side played out a 1-1 draw with Chelsea in the first leg of their Champions League last-16 tie.

Despite conceding a crucial away goal against the Premier League leaders, PSG remain in the hunt for a place in the quarter-finals, and Blanc will be under pressure to deliver the goods at Stamford Bridge next month.

Before then, the defence of their title must take centre stage, and all eyes are on PSG as they continue to search for their best form in Ligue 1.

All three title challengers slipped up with draws last weekend, and Blanc will expect a response after his side threw away a two-goal advantage to be held to a 2-2 draw by Caen.

Lyon and Marseille do not return to action until Sunday, which means that PSG can go a point clear of the former with a win over Toulouse.

Alain Casanova's side climbed out of the relegation zone last weekend with a 2-1 victory over Rennes, and the morale-boosting win is likely to see the visitors name an unchanged side.

David Luiz is likely to move back into the centre of defence after playing in midfield against Chelsea, while Adrien Rabiot could be handed a start.
